Ratha and Thistle-Chaser, Named Book #3, drew inspiration from Susan Vega's song "In the Eye". http://www.last.fm/music/Suzanne+Vega/_/In+the+Eye

Take a look at the song's lyrics and you'll see the beginning of the book's theme. Which lines do you think had the strongest effect on the relationship between Ratha and Thistle? http://www.elyrics.net/read/s/suzanne-vega-lyrics/in-the-eye-lyrics.html

"In the Eye" is the most powerful, relentless, brutally honest song I have ever heard. All the lines helped inspire Thistle's character in the book. "I would not run, I would not turn, I would not hide. In the eye. Look me in the eye."

More about Suzanne Vega: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Suzanne_Vega

I have left a message for Ms. Vega, telling her that her music inspired my work. I'm hoping she will respond. She's still active and recording.
